(ABS) 

This slow-moving class combines yin and restorative yoga. Yin Yoga and Restorative Yoga are stress-relieving practices that stimulate the parasympathetic nervous system and promoting relaxation. Yin Yoga is all about releasing deeply held tension in the physical body and unleashing stagnant or blocked energy. Restorative Yoga focuses more on being 100% supported with blocks and bolsters, allowing your body to relax & heal. It is a much more passive practice than Yin (less active stretching, more surrendering). Class will begin and end with Savasana (or a guided meditation) so you can find peace of mind and give your body the rest it has been craving.

(ABS)

Yin is a perfect early morning practice to help loosen your body up for the day ahead. This slow-paced and meditative class consists of a series of seated and supine postures, typically held for 3-5 minutes at a time. During these periods of stillness, you will release repressed or stored tension in the body, leaving you feeling lighter, clearer and completely relaxed. This class is different than our flow or movement based classes where there is a proper warm up and cool down. Yin Yoga is meant to be practiced mindfully with a "cold" body so that you can find a profound release of tension in the deeper lying tissues of the body, and significantly increase range of motion. This is a great class for anyone with "tight" muscles, lower back/hip pain, or sore joints.

(ABF)

Awaken and align your body with this rejuvenating morning class. In Hatha Yoga, students can expect to practice a slow sequence of traditional yoga postures. This class is more fluid than a Yin class, but much less intensive than a Vinyasa class. The focus in Hatha Yoga is to bring mind-body connection through mindful breathing as we transition from one pose to another. This a great class for those seeking gentle, low-impact movement that is not stressful on your body's joints. 

(ABF)

Come flow and release stress in the body using movement and breath. Together we'll practice moving mindfully through a sequence of dynamic poses with smooth transitions. The focus of Vinyasa is to sync each movement with your breath as we flow from one poses to another, helping to build heat and energy in the body. In class, poses will only be for a few second at a time as we are flowing but students can expect some long holds weaved into class. This class is less intense than Power Yoga, but much more fluid than our other gentle yoga offerings. While we'll be in continuous movement, there is no competition or pressure to keep up. This is a lighthearted class. Students are welcome to take breaks or find rest any time during class.

(ABH)

Barre is a fun, high-energy workout is designed to trim, tighten and tone your entire body with an emphasis on defining your glutes and legs. By using small, controlled movements, isometric holds and high repetition, you can develop a strong, long, and lean physique without the risks associated with a high impact class. This class is also great for toning your upper body and core. Combining Cardio, Pilates, Ballet, and our own bodyweight, we aim to develop our strength, coordination, and center.
